Short description of error
The corner handle on image objects are drawn too big in the viewport when moused over/near.
Exact steps for others to reproduce the error
Open the default scene.
Add > Image > Reference (use any image file)
Gigantic yellow boxes appear where the image object should be.
You may need to move your mouse closer to it if they don't show up.
